Transaction d662ed9cc641ebb072c0249cbebba65bc52414e00f1727b76b0862107a624180

1 Input
2 Outputs
  • d662ed9cc641ebb072c0249cbebba65bc52414e00f1727b76b0862107a624180:0
  • value  858345722
    address  3GiCZQeLtZSZR4KZXDARWWMSnKcCB7F1LU
  • d662ed9cc641ebb072c0249cbebba65bc52414e00f1727b76b0862107a624180:1
  • value  16381263
    address  187arhapXewXTeoiWbeZkaKpMwH1yq5BJW